Creating the Ideal Habitat for Hedgehogs

Creating the ideal habitat for your hedgehog is crucial for their well-being. Start with a spacious enclosure, at least 4 square feet in size, with good ventilation. Use a solid-bottomed cage to prevent injuries to their feet. Provide bedding like aspen shavings or paper-based bedding for burrowing and nesting. Include hiding spots like igloos or tunnels for security. Offer a wheel for exercise, ensuring it is solid and large enough for your hedgehog. Maintain a warm temperature around 72-80°F and avoid drafts. Provide a shallow dish for water and a separate dish for high-quality hedgehog food. Keep the habitat clean by spot cleaning daily and doing a full clean weekly. Enrich the environment with toys like balls or puzzle feeders to stimulate their minds. Lastly, ensure the enclosure is escape-proof to keep your hedgehog safe.
